PPU loads this M200-pattern 5.56×45 blank (part no. PPB556) for units, reenactors, and trainers who need the report and muzzle flash of a live round without a projectile leaving the barrel. The case mouth is crimped in place of a bullet, so it fires safely for honor guard details, historical reenactment, and blank-firing-adapter-equipped rifles used in dog and livestock training. Because there is no bullet, a standard gas-operated rifle will not cycle on this round without a blank-firing adapter matched to the platform. Frequently Asked Questions
Will this cycle a semi-automatic rifle? Only if the rifle is fitted with a blank-firing adapter designed for it, since there is no bullet to cycle the action normally.
Is this safe to fire without any target downrange? There is no projectile, but muzzle blast at close range is still hazardous, so standard firearm safety distances still apply.
